package com.google.firebase.auth;

import static com.google.common.base.Preconditions.checkArgument;

import com.google.common.collect.ImmutableList;
import com.google.firebase.auth.internal.UploadAccountResponse;
import com.google.firebase.internal.NonNull;
import java.util.List;

/**
 * Represents the result of the {@link FirebaseAuth#importUsersAsync(List, UserImportOptions)} API.
 */
public final class UserImportResult {

    private final int users;
    private final ImmutableList<ErrorInfo> errors;

    UserImportResult(int users, UploadAccountResponse response) {
        ImmutableList.Builder<ErrorInfo> errorsBuilder = ImmutableList.builder();
        List<UploadAccountResponse.ErrorInfo> errors = response.getErrors();
        if (errors != null) {
            checkArgument(users >= errors.size());
            for (UploadAccountResponse.ErrorInfo error : errors) {
                errorsBuilder.add(new ErrorInfo(error.getIndex(), error.getMessage()));
            }
        }
        this.users = users;
        this.errors = errorsBuilder.build();
    }

    /**
     * Returns the number of users that were imported successfully.
     *
     * @return number of users successfully imported (possibly zero).
     */
    public int getSuccessCount() {
        return users - errors.size();
    }

    /**
     * Returns the number of users that failed to be imported.
     *
     * @return number of users that resulted in import failures (possibly zero).
     */
    public int getFailureCount() {
        return errors.size();
    }

    /**
     * A list of {@link ErrorInfo} instances describing the errors that were encountered during
     * the import. Length of this list is equal to the return value of {@link #getFailureCount()}.
     *
     * @return A non-null list (possibly empty).
     */
    @NonNull
    public List<ErrorInfo> getErrors() {
        return errors;
    }
}
